May 20th - The Mysterious Disappearance of Frederick Valentich

On October 21, 1978, a peculiar event took place that has puzzled investigators for decades. Frederick Valentich, a 20-year-old pilot, embarked on a routine training flight from Moorabbin Airport in Victoria, Australia. However, what started as an ordinary flight soon turned into one of the most baffling disappearances in aviation history.

During his flight, Valentich reported to air traffic control that he was being accompanied by an unidentified aircraft. He described the craft as having four bright lights and moving at high speed. The young pilot also mentioned that the object was orbiting above him and that it had a shiny, metallic surface with a green light on it.

In his final transmission, Valentich said, "It is hovering, and it's not an aircraft." After that, all contact with him was lost, and neither Valentich nor his plane was ever seen again.

Despite an extensive search and rescue operation, no trace of the aircraft or the pilot was found. The disappearance sparked a wave of speculation about UFO involvement, as Valentich's description of the unidentified object matched that of many reported UFO sightings.

Some theories suggest that Valentich might have been abducted by extraterrestrials, while others believe he staged his own disappearance. Another hypothesis is that he became disoriented and crashed into the ocean, but this doesn't explain the lack of wreckage or an oil slick on the water.

The case remains unsolved to this day, leaving many wondering what truly happened to Frederick Valentich on that fateful night. The mysterious disappearance has become a staple in the annals of unexplained phenomena and continues to captivate the minds of those who seek answers to the unknown.
